Raise the ISO speed when you wish to reduce the effects of shaking
hands and shoot with the flash off in a dark area or when you wish to
reduce the effects of a moving subject and raise the shutter speed.

zWhen Auto is selected, the optimal speed is selected based on
the brightness of the environment at the time of shooting. The
speed is automatically increased in dark places, increasing the
shutter speed and reducing shaking effects.
zWhen is selected, a speed higher than when using Auto is
selected. The shutter speed increases even more, and
blurriness from hand or subject movement in a scene is less
than when taken in Auto. There may be an increase in noise,
however, when compared to Auto.
